Tami Lahey, an 11 year old Baton Twirler from Naples has won four first places and the Titles of All Star Misss and All Star Miss Twirler at the Florida State Junior Olympic Qualifiers in Winter Haven, FL. Now, she will compete in the Junior Olympics in Detroit, Michigan! She is also the Captain of Naples Sunsation Twirlers.
Supported by Naples Mayor Bill Barnett and former Pro Bowl QB for the Saint Louis Cardinals, Jim Hart as well as numerous other donors, Tami is hopeful that she can get to the Junior Olympics and bring back a medal that all Naples residents and Floridians can be proud of!
Tami said "I am honored to have competed against such fine twirlers and I hope that I am able to get to Michigan to compete with more. I give 110% to my sport. I try and practice hard. If I get there, I hope I have a good day"!
